It’s going to be a good day.

Why? It’s Pokémon Day, of course, celebrated on 27 February every year.

Later today, The Pokémon Company will host its latest Pokémon Presents event.

If you do want to tune in, it’s due to be held at 2pm GMT / 6am PST.

Advert

I’m imagining that we’ll receive an update on the upcoming Pokémon Legends Z-A which is due to launch this year, assumedly on the Nintendo Switch 2.

There are plenty of other rumours doing the rounds, with many wondering if we could see a multiplayer title or classic remake unveiled.

Admittedly, I think we should all temper our expectations.

You see, Pokémon is due to celebrate its 30th anniversary next year, so I’m imagining it’s then that we’ll welcome a bumper Pokémon Presents.

Already, fans are bursting with excitement over what next year’s Pokémon game might have in store.

Last year’s Pokémon Presents brought us the first reveal trailer for Pokémon Legends Z-A.

I can’t quite decide how I think The Pokémon Company might celebrate the occasion.

Given that Red and Green began the franchise, it would make the most sense to revisit those titles but, as you know, Red and Green have already been remade.

That being said, I’d love to see them reimagined in the HD2D style popularised by Square Enix.

“They gotta really make one of the best Pokémon games of all time,” one Reddit user said of the occasion.

“Nothing's probably topping original Gen 1 and original Gen 2. If you lived through it like I did, you will know how epic those were. But they could at least aim to make the third best Pokémon game of all time.”

“I just hope that for once they release the masterpiece that the franchise deserves on console,” added LandscapeOk2955.

There’s no need for us to speculate on the future though when new announcements are coming our way today.

It goes without saying that we’ll be here bringing you the latest headlines during today’s Pokémon Presents event.
